Home
/
Gold markets
/
Other
/

Understanding binary tables: a clear guide

Understanding Binary Tables: A Clear Guide

By

Lucas Mitchell

08 May 2026, 00:00

12 minutes (approx.)

Launch

Binary tables form the backbone of data representation in digital systems. At their core, these tables organise information using just two symbols: 0 and 1. This binary format aligns perfectly with how computers operate, relying on electrical signals that are either off or on. Whether you're dealing with stock market data, analysing trading algorithms, or teaching computing concepts, binary tables offer a clear, practical way to model information.

Understanding how binary tables are structured helps you grasp their wide range of applications. Each row typically represents an entry or record, while columns correspond to specific data points that can only be in a state of 0 or 1. This simplicity can encode complex information – think of how a boolean table shows whether a condition is true (1) or false (0) across multiple criteria. For example, a trader might use a binary table to track the presence or absence of signals like moving average crosses, where 1 indicates a crossover and 0 means no crossover.

Diagram showing the structure of a binary table with rows and columns filled with zeros and ones
top

The power of binary tables lies in their ability to simplify decision-making processes by representing conditions clearly and compactly.

For analysts, these tables lend themselves well to creating logic diagrams or truth tables, essential in designing automated trading bots or risk assessment models. Brokers and educators also find value in binary tables when illustrating key concepts such as market indicators, trade approvals, or system states.

Here’s why binary tables stand out:

  • Clarity: Each entry is explicitly defined as 0 or 1, reducing ambiguity.

  • Efficiency: Binary data consumes less memory, improving computation speed.

  • Versatility: Adaptable to various fields like computing, finance, and data science.

To create a binary table, start by defining the variables you wish to track. For instance, an investor could monitor three indicators — price above moving average, volume increase, and RSI threshold — with these variables laid out as columns. Each trading day forms a row, filled with 0s and 1s reflecting whether those conditions were met.

Reading these tables is straightforward. Spotting patterns or specific combinations of 1s can reveal insights into market behaviour or system triggers. For example, a certain binary pattern might coincide with profitable trades, guiding future decisions.

In sum, binary tables are a no-nonsense tool to organise, analyse, and communicate binary data efficiently. Their role in digital systems and decision-making underscores their value across professions dealing with structured information.

What a Binary Table Is and How It Works

A binary table is a straightforward way to organise and represent data using just two values, typically 0 and 1. This method forms the backbone of how computers process information, making an understanding of its workings essential for anyone involved in computing, programming, or data analysis. Beyond theory, binary tables allow traders, analysts, and educators to visualise complex decision-making processes and logical relationships in a clear, structured format.

The Basics of Binary Representation

Understanding Binary Digits

Binary digits, or bits, are the smallest units of data in computing. A '0' or '1' represents off or on states, which can correspond to electrical signals in hardware or coded instructions in software.

Practically, this simplicity enables computers to perform calculations and store information efficiently. For instance, a black-and-white image saved on a computer uses binary digits to represent pixels—0 for black and 1 for white—allowing for compressed storage and fast processing.

How Binary Relates to Tables

Binary tables organise these 0s and 1s systematically, making them easier to interpret and apply. Imagine a trade decision matrix where '1' means 'buy' and '0' means 'hold or sell'; arranging these outcomes in a table helps clarify strategies.

Similarly, in logical circuits, binary tables called truth tables display how different input combinations (0 or 1) lead to specific outputs, guiding engineers when designing complex electronics.

Structure of a Binary Table

Rows, Columns, and Binary Values

A binary table is composed of rows and columns, each holding binary values representing different variables or conditions. Rows might list possible scenarios or input states, while columns represent variables or outputs.

For example, a truth table for a simple AND gate has two input columns and one output column, with each row showing how the inputs determine the output (1 only when both inputs are 1).

Common Formats and Layouts

Binary tables usually follow clear, standard formats to help users quickly grasp information. The most typical layout is tabular, with headers identifying variables and outputs.

In some cases, tables can be extended to multiple variables, but the fundamental logic remains the same—each row depicts a unique combination of inputs with corresponding binary outcomes. This layout is invaluable when testing or debugging algorithms or circuits.

Binary tables are essential tools that simplify complex binary data into readable, actionable formats, making them indispensable across computing, electronics, and data analysis.

Using Binary Tables in Computing

Binary tables play a key role in computing by organising binary data in a clear, accessible format. They help us translate complex logical and numerical information into simple ones and zeros, which machines can easily process. This makes them invaluable across various computing fields, including digital logic design and data storage.

Binary Tables in Digital Logic and Circuits

Example of a binary table used for data representation in digital systems
top

Truth Tables for Logical Operations

Truth tables are a classic example of binary tables in action. They illustrate the output of logical operations—like AND, OR, NOT, XOR—across all possible input combinations. For instance, in designing a logic circuit, a truth table specifies what the output should be for every set of binary inputs. This clarity is crucial when testing circuits or programming digital devices.

By laying out inputs and corresponding outputs in a straightforward table, engineers can quickly pinpoint errors or unexpected behaviours in circuits. Truth tables also form the backbone of Boolean algebra simplification, which helps minimise the number of gates needed in electronic designs, saving space and power.

Applications in Electronics

In electronics, binary tables help translate real-world signals into digital forms for processing. Devices like microcontrollers or FPGAs rely on truth tables to perform tasks ranging from simple switches to complex computations. For example, a traffic robot controller uses binary tables to determine signal states based on sensor inputs.

Moreover, in troubleshooting electronic systems, technicians use binary tables to track signal changes and verify component behaviour. By comparing expected binary outcomes with actual outputs, they can isolate faults faster than relying on guesswork alone.

Binary Tables for Data Storage and Encoding

Representing Information Efficiently

Binary tables offer a compact way to store and organise data. Since digital storage devices work on binary principles, arranging data in binary tables ensures efficient use of storage capacity. Take image files, for example: each pixel’s colour information is broken down into binary values—stored and retrieved through binary tables for accurate display.

In data transmission, binary tables help standardise encoding schemes like ASCII or Unicode. By defining fixed binary codes for characters, computers worldwide can communicate without pixelating text or losing meaning. This uniformity is essential for everything from emails to software interfaces.

Binary Tables in File Formats

Common file formats like PNG, MP3, and PDF incorporate binary tables to manage metadata, file headers, and content encoding. These tables specify how different sections of data are organised and interpreted by software. For instance, a PNG image file uses tables to define chunks containing image data, palette information, and transparency.

Using binary tables in file formats also allows for error detection and correction features. This ensures files remain intact during transfers or storage, a vital aspect when dealing with sensitive financial data or large datasets.

Efficient use of binary tables makes digital systems more reliable and manageable, directly impacting computing performance and user experience.

By understanding how binary tables function in computing, professionals like analysts and programmers can better design systems, troubleshoot problems, and optimise data handling in their respective fields.

Creating and Reading Binary Tables

Understanding how to create and read binary tables is essential for anyone dealing with digital logic, data analysis, or computing at large. Binary tables simplify complex information into a clear, two-symbol format—typically zeros and ones—making it easier to spot patterns and make logical decisions. For traders and analysts, this skill can be particularly handy when working with algorithmic trading strategies or digital data sets.

Steps to Construct a Binary Table

Defining Variables and Conditions

The first step in constructing a binary table involves identifying the variables involved and the conditions that affect them. For example, if you’re looking at a trading algorithm, your variables might be indicators such as market momentum, volume, or price movement, each with binary states like ‘high’ or ‘low’. Defining these variables upfront gives structure and purpose to your table.

Once the variables are clear, set the conditions under which each variable will switch states. This groundwork ensures the binary table is meaningful, capturing all relevant scenarios comprehensively and without confusion.

Filling the Table with Binary Values

After setting variables and conditions, proceed to fill the table rows with binary values—0s and 1s—that represent each possible state combination. This step requires careful attention to detail to ensure that all permutations are covered. For instance, in a table with two variables, you’d have four rows representing every combination (00, 01, 10, 11).

Accurate entry here is critical. Incorrect values can lead to misinterpretations, which, in analytical contexts like stock market signals or system fault detection, may have costly consequences. Using systematic methods, such as truth tables or binary counting sequences, can help keep this process error-free.

Interpreting Binary Table Data

Analysing Patterns and Outcomes

Binary tables reveal clear-cut patterns by structuring data so it’s easy to compare combinations of variables. For instance, by analysing a table that maps trading signals, you can quickly identify which variable combinations trigger buy or sell actions. Recognising these patterns supports better decision-making and optimises strategy outcomes.

Additionally, binary tables allow spotting anomalies or unexpected results quickly. If a particular combination doesn't align with expected outcomes, it signals that further investigation may be necessary.

Analysing binary outcomes offers a straightforward way to untangle complex decisions, making it easier to interpret the often confusing world of data.

Using Binary Tables for Problem Solving

Beyond analysis, binary tables serve as functional tools for problem solving. They can simplify logical conditions, aid in debugging algorithms, or assist in designing electronic circuits. For example, in algorithm development, a binary table can help trace which inputs lead to specific outputs, revealing logical gaps or inefficiencies.

In practice, traders can use these tables to simulate various market conditions and determine how certain indicators interplay. This practical application supports creating robust trading algorithms resistant to unforeseen market fluctuations.

In sum, mastering how to create and interpret binary tables equips you with a powerful way to organise, evaluate, and act on binary data efficiently—skills that are increasingly valuable in a digital, data-driven South African environment.

Practical Examples and Use Cases

Understanding how binary tables function in real-world scenarios helps bridge the gap between theory and practical application. This section focuses on specific examples where binary tables play a key role, offering traders, investors, analysts, brokers, and educators insightful uses of these tools. Through concrete cases, you can see how binary tables simplify complex decisions, making information clearer and more actionable.

Truth Tables for Logic Gates

Truth tables are classic binary tables that show how logic gates operate. Each row represents a unique combination of binary inputs, and the corresponding output shows the gate’s result. For example, an AND gate truth table lists inputs as 0s and 1s, and only outputs a 1 when both inputs are 1. This simple layout helps hardware designers and analysts verify circuit behaviour or troubleshoot logic errors quickly. In trade algorithm design or risk assessment models, these same principles apply when simplifying binary conditions.

Binary Tables in Programming

Conditional Statements and Binary Decisions

In programming, binary tables illustrate conditional statements as straightforward yes/no or true/false decisions. For instance, a trader’s algorithm might have a condition such as “If the stock price rises above R100, then buy; else, do nothing.” This condition turns into a binary outcome: '1' for buy, and '0' for no action. Visualising this in a binary table helps programmers and analysts map out all possible input conditions and the resulting action. This clarity aids debugging, ensures logical consistency, and speeds up code optimisation.

Binary decisions extend beyond simple buy or sell commands. Complex financial models involve nested conditions where each binary choice affects the next step. Binary tables make these chain reactions easier to follow by breaking down the decision paths into manageable pieces.

Simplifying Algorithms

Binary tables play a major role in simplifying complex algorithms. By arranging all input variables and respective outputs, developers can spot redundant conditions or simplify calculations. This process, often called Boolean simplification, reduces the amount of processing power needed, which is crucial in high-frequency trading systems where milliseconds matter.

Consider a broker developing an algorithm to filter stocks based on multiple binary indicators like volume spikes, price momentum, and news sentiment. Presenting these inputs and outputs in a binary table makes it easier to identify when various conditions overlap unnecessarily. Simplifying the algorithm reduces risk of errors and improves system speed.

Binary tables turn abstract, multilayered decisions into clear-cut, manageable data, which is why they’re a staple in programming and algorithm design.

By drawing on practical examples—from logic gates in hardware to binary decisions in trading software—this section highlights the valuable role binary tables play. Whether you’re an analyst trying to streamline a report or a broker coding a trading bot, understanding these use cases sharpens your grasp of digital logic and effective decision-making.

Common Challenges and Tips for Working with Binary Tables

Working with binary tables isn’t always straightforward. Despite their clear structure, errors can creep in, especially when tables become large or complex. This section addresses practical challenges you might face with binary tables and offers tips that save time and avoid costly mistakes.

Avoiding Errors in Binary Data

Ensuring Accuracy in Entries

Accuracy in recording binary values is essential because a single misplaced one or zero can change the entire interpretation of data. For example, in truth tables that determine logic gate outputs, if one entry is off, downstream circuits or software relying on that data might fail unexpectedly. It’s wise to double-check entries or use verification methods like cross-referencing with expected logical rules. A hands-on way to reduce mistakes is to have a fresh set of eyes review your binary table or compare outputs using simple scripts for validation.

Checking Logical Consistency

Beyond just getting the zeros and ones right, ensuring that the overall table makes sense logically is key. For instance, when mapping conditional decisions in an algorithm, certain binary combinations should never appear if the logic is consistent. Detecting these anomalies early avoids weeks of debugging later. One approach is to manually walk through scenarios represented by your table or use logic simulation tools to highlight inconsistencies. Remember, logical errors can be harder to spot than typographical ones, so systematic reviews or software-assisted checks can be very helpful.

Tools and Resources to Help

Software for Creating Binary Tables

Modern software makes constructing and manipulating binary tables much more manageable. Programs like Microsoft Excel or Google Sheets can handle simple tables with ease, offering custom formulas and conditional formatting to flag errors instantly. For heavier-duty or specialised tasks, tools like Logisim (for designing digital circuits) or Python libraries such as Pandas (data manipulation) give you more power to automate and validate tables. These tools not only speed up the process but also reduce human error.

Educational Resources and Practice Exercises

Getting comfortable with binary tables takes practice, so don’t shy away from exercises tailored for digital logic or programming. University open course lectures on platforms like Coursera or Khan Academy often include practical tasks and quizzes focused on binary logic. For South African learners, local technical colleges and online tutorials can provide examples relevant to real-world contexts, such as encoding data for telecommunications or digital finance systems. Practising regularly hones your skill in spotting errors and understanding complex binary patterns.

Mistakes in binary tables can cause ripple effects in computing and financial modelling; taking time to verify and use proper tools pays off in reliability and confidence.

Handling binary tables well means embracing accuracy, double-checking logic, and using the right software and learning resources. With these approaches, you’ll build stronger, error-free binary tables that serve your analysis or systems effectively.

FAQ

Similar Articles

Understanding Binary Tools and Their Uses

Understanding Binary Tools and Their Uses

🔧 Discover how binary tools work and their key uses in software, cybersecurity, and data analysis. Get practical tips on choosing tools and handling common user challenges.

4.2/5

Based on 10 reviews